Skip navigation links
A C D E G I O R S 

A

AbstractAsyncServiceFactory - Class in org.apache.chemistry.opencmis.server.async.impl
An AsyncCmisServiceFactory implementation that sets up one simple ThreadPoolExecutor for executing asynchronous all CMIS requests.
AbstractAsyncServiceFactory() - Constructor for class org.apache.chemistry.opencmis.server.async.impl.AbstractAsyncServiceFactory
 
AsyncCmisAtomPubServlet - Class in org.apache.chemistry.opencmis.server.async.impl.atompub
Async CMIS AtomPub servlet.
AsyncCmisAtomPubServlet() - Constructor for class org.apache.chemistry.opencmis.server.async.impl.atompub.AsyncCmisAtomPubServlet
 
AsyncCmisBrowserBindingServlet - Class in org.apache.chemistry.opencmis.server.async.impl.browser
Async CMIS Browser binding servlet.
AsyncCmisBrowserBindingServlet() - Constructor for class org.apache.chemistry.opencmis.server.async.impl.browser.AsyncCmisBrowserBindingServlet
 
AsyncCmisExecutor - Interface in org.apache.chemistry.opencmis.server.async
Implementations of this interface are responsible for executing a CMIS request asynchronously.
AsyncCmisServiceFactory - Interface in org.apache.chemistry.opencmis.server.async
Factory for CmisService objects that support asynchronous execution.
AsyncCmisServlet - Interface in org.apache.chemistry.opencmis.server.async.impl
Marks a servlet as an asynchronous CMIS servlet.
AsyncCmisWebServicesServlet - Class in org.apache.chemistry.opencmis.server.async.impl.webservices
Async CMIS Web Services servlet.
AsyncCmisWebServicesServlet() - Constructor for class org.apache.chemistry.opencmis.server.async.impl.webservices.AsyncCmisWebServicesServlet
 

C

CmisAsyncHelper - Class in org.apache.chemistry.opencmis.server.async.impl
 
CmisRequestRunner - Class in org.apache.chemistry.opencmis.server.async.impl
Runner that executes an asynchronous CMIS request.
CmisRequestRunner(AsyncContext, AsyncCmisServlet) - Constructor for class org.apache.chemistry.opencmis.server.async.impl.CmisRequestRunner
 

D

destroy() - Method in class org.apache.chemistry.opencmis.server.async.impl.AbstractAsyncServiceFactory
 
destroy() - Method in class org.apache.chemistry.opencmis.server.async.impl.SimpleAsyncCmisExecutor
Waits until all running threads are stopped.

E

execute(AsyncContext, Runnable) - Method in interface org.apache.chemistry.opencmis.server.async.AsyncCmisExecutor
Executes a CMIS request.
execute(AsyncContext, Runnable) - Method in class org.apache.chemistry.opencmis.server.async.impl.SimpleAsyncCmisExecutor
 
executeAsync(AsyncCmisServlet, HttpServletRequest, HttpServletResponse) - Static method in class org.apache.chemistry.opencmis.server.async.impl.CmisAsyncHelper
Executes a request asynchronously.
executeSync(HttpServletRequest, HttpServletResponse) - Method in interface org.apache.chemistry.opencmis.server.async.impl.AsyncCmisServlet
Executes the synchronous part of this servlet.
executeSync(HttpServletRequest, HttpServletResponse) - Method in class org.apache.chemistry.opencmis.server.async.impl.atompub.AsyncCmisAtomPubServlet
 
executeSync(HttpServletRequest, HttpServletResponse) - Method in class org.apache.chemistry.opencmis.server.async.impl.browser.AsyncCmisBrowserBindingServlet
 
executeSync(HttpServletRequest, HttpServletResponse) - Method in class org.apache.chemistry.opencmis.server.async.impl.webservices.AsyncCmisWebServicesServlet
 

G

getAsyncCmisExecutor(HttpServletRequest, HttpServletResponse) - Method in interface org.apache.chemistry.opencmis.server.async.AsyncCmisServiceFactory
Returns an AsyncCmisExecutor instance that handles the asynchronous execution of this request.
getAsyncCmisExecutor(HttpServletRequest, HttpServletResponse) - Method in class org.apache.chemistry.opencmis.server.async.impl.AbstractAsyncServiceFactory
 
getAsyncCmisExecutor(ServletConfig, HttpServletRequest, HttpServletResponse) - Static method in class org.apache.chemistry.opencmis.server.async.impl.CmisAsyncHelper
Gets the service factory and get the AsyncCmisExecutor instance.
getTimeout() - Method in class org.apache.chemistry.opencmis.server.async.impl.SimpleAsyncCmisExecutor
Gets the timeout for the AsyncContext.

I

init(Map<String, String>) - Method in class org.apache.chemistry.opencmis.server.async.impl.AbstractAsyncServiceFactory
 

O

onComplete(AsyncEvent) - Method in class org.apache.chemistry.opencmis.server.async.impl.SimpleCmisAsyncListener
 
onError(AsyncEvent) - Method in class org.apache.chemistry.opencmis.server.async.impl.SimpleCmisAsyncListener
 
onStartAsync(AsyncEvent) - Method in class org.apache.chemistry.opencmis.server.async.impl.SimpleCmisAsyncListener
 
onTimeout(AsyncEvent) - Method in class org.apache.chemistry.opencmis.server.async.impl.SimpleCmisAsyncListener
 
org.apache.chemistry.opencmis.server.async - package org.apache.chemistry.opencmis.server.async
 
org.apache.chemistry.opencmis.server.async.impl - package org.apache.chemistry.opencmis.server.async.impl
 
org.apache.chemistry.opencmis.server.async.impl.atompub - package org.apache.chemistry.opencmis.server.async.impl.atompub
 
org.apache.chemistry.opencmis.server.async.impl.browser - package org.apache.chemistry.opencmis.server.async.impl.browser
 
org.apache.chemistry.opencmis.server.async.impl.webservices - package org.apache.chemistry.opencmis.server.async.impl.webservices
 

R

run() - Method in class org.apache.chemistry.opencmis.server.async.impl.CmisRequestRunner
 

S

sendError(Exception, HttpServletRequest, HttpServletResponse) - Method in interface org.apache.chemistry.opencmis.server.async.impl.AsyncCmisServlet
Sends an error to client.
sendError(Exception, HttpServletRequest, HttpServletResponse) - Method in class org.apache.chemistry.opencmis.server.async.impl.atompub.AsyncCmisAtomPubServlet
 
sendError(Exception, HttpServletRequest, HttpServletResponse) - Method in class org.apache.chemistry.opencmis.server.async.impl.browser.AsyncCmisBrowserBindingServlet
 
sendError(Exception, HttpServletRequest, HttpServletResponse) - Method in class org.apache.chemistry.opencmis.server.async.impl.webservices.AsyncCmisWebServicesServlet
 
service(HttpServletRequest, HttpServletResponse) - Method in class org.apache.chemistry.opencmis.server.async.impl.atompub.AsyncCmisAtomPubServlet
 
service(HttpServletRequest, HttpServletResponse) - Method in class org.apache.chemistry.opencmis.server.async.impl.browser.AsyncCmisBrowserBindingServlet
 
service(HttpServletRequest, HttpServletResponse) - Method in class org.apache.chemistry.opencmis.server.async.impl.webservices.AsyncCmisWebServicesServlet
 
setTimeout(long) - Method in class org.apache.chemistry.opencmis.server.async.impl.SimpleAsyncCmisExecutor
Sets the timeout for the AsyncContext.
SimpleAsyncCmisExecutor - Class in org.apache.chemistry.opencmis.server.async.impl
A simple AsyncCmisExecutor implementation that uses a ThreadPoolExecutor for executing asynchronous CMIS requests.
SimpleAsyncCmisExecutor() - Constructor for class org.apache.chemistry.opencmis.server.async.impl.SimpleAsyncCmisExecutor
 
SimpleCmisAsyncListener - Class in org.apache.chemistry.opencmis.server.async.impl
Simple listener for asynchronous events (for debugging and error messages).
SimpleCmisAsyncListener() - Constructor for class org.apache.chemistry.opencmis.server.async.impl.SimpleCmisAsyncListener
 
A C D E G I O R S 
Skip navigation links

Copyright © 2009–2016 The Apache Software Foundation. All rights reserved.